Anyone know what kind of tank I should be considering for tropical diving?


Also I just was curious as to travelling policy with regards to tanks

Gordo
 
I use the tanks of the dive operators who I dive with. Most divers do not travel with their own tanks, as the valves have to be removed and this can allow moisture in causing corrosion.
 
I agree, tanks are just too big and heavy to mess with trying to haul around on a plane. The cost of rental is not much compaired to the rest of the trip and certainly not expensive enough to make it worth while for me to carry them.
 
AL 80 cuFt are popular tanks used in the tropics. It's better to rent these rather than attempt to travel with them.
